HN to name street after General Giap

VGP – Ha Noi’s Culture, Sports and Tourism Department will propose the naming of a major street in the capital after General Vo Nguyen Giap.

October 08, 2013 6:31 PM GMT+7

Deputy Director of the department Truong Minh Tien said on October 7 that normally a street is renamed after a celebrity when he/she died for at least 10 years. However, for the case of General Giap, the department will submit the proposal to the Hanoi’s People Committee right after his death.

According to Tien, the department is considering a suitable street corresponding to the General’s great merits to the country.

General Vo Nguyen Giap, former commander-in-chief of the Viet Nam People’s Army, who masterminded the defeats of France and the United States, passed away in Ha Noi on October 4 at the age of 103./.
